Inverters play a crucial role in microgrids by converting direct current (DC) power from renewable energy sources like solar panels and wind turbines into alternating current (AC) power that can be used by appliances and devices. The inverter provides the MicroGrid with as much PV energy as possible. Inverters also help regulate voltage and frequency within the. . For a typical three-bedroom home requiring a 3kVA to 7kVA system, costs range from KSh 350,000 ($3,400) to KSh 700,000 ($6,800), according to Voltmatic Energy Solutions, a leading installer in Kenya. This includes solar panels, an inverter, batteries, and labour. . What cost KSh 500,000 three years ago now goes for around KSh 350,000. Chinese manufacturing got better, more competition entered Kenya, and suddenly, solar isn't just for rich folks in Karen anymore.
